Fresh Mint Lemonade

This is a delicious refreshment I've created myself for hot summer days. With a trace of mint and a sprig of rosemary your sure to enjoy. Dylan, Creator

SERVES 5 , 5 cups (change servings and units)

Directions

  1. 1
    First cut and juice the lemons and put it into a pitcher.
  2. 2
    Rinse the mint and rosemary. Then tear apart the mint and rosemary, allowing the flavor to unleash. Put it in the pitcher with or without strainer.
  3. 3
    Add the water to the pitcher.
  4. 4
    Fill a microwavable cup with the sugar and just enough water to cover the top of the sugar and heat in microwave for 1.5 minutes.
  5. 5
    Finally stir the sugar and water until it all dissolves then pour it into the pitcher and add ice if you like. Stir and enjoy!
